What does राज mean?

Rāja is a Sanskrit word meaning 'king' or 'ruler'. In Hindu mythology, Rāja is a title given to various gods and heroes. It is also a common name for boys in India.

Spiritual & cultural context

Symbolizes leadership, power, and authority.

The name Rāja holds significant cultural importance in India, representing power, authority, and leadership. It is a title that has been associated with various gods and heroes in Hindu mythology, such as Indra, the king of the gods, and RAMA, the ideal king and protagonist of the epic Ramayana. The term Raja has also been used to denote rulers and monarchs in Indian history.
